
Frank Matthews, the former talk show host turned mayoral flunky, is causing a stir again. On Friday Matthews got into an on-air shouting match with talk show host Matt Murphy, ranting and raving on WAPI’s airwaves for about five minutes before Murphy hung up on him.
Murphy said today that Matthews had been cordial with him off the air, but once on the show, the two of them began talking over each other. Murphy said that, after listening to the recording, he still couldn’t make out everything Matthews was saying.
“It sounds like he called me a fat pig and a fat slob, but we’re not sure if he challenged me a debate or a fight,” Murphy said.
Murphy said he invited Matthews on the show after a John Archibald column ran in the Birmingham News. That column accused Matthews of taking political payola from Mayor Larry Langford while Matthews hosted a paid-programming show on WAPI. After the election, Mayor Langford appointed Matthews to his current job at Birmingham City Hall.
